    Meaning in Language

    Meaning refers to the significance or interpretation of a word, phrase, or symbol. It is the understanding that we derive from language, allowing us to communicate ideas, thoughts, and feelings.

    The meaning of a word can be:

    • Denotative: The literal or dictionary definition of a word.
    • Connotative: The emotional associations or cultural implications associated with a word.

    Meaning is not fixed and can vary depending on:

    • Context: The surrounding words and situation influence how a word is understood.
    • Culture: Different cultures may have different meanings for the same word.
    • Individual Interpretation: Each person may interpret a word based on their own experiences and perspectives.

    The study of meaning in language is called Semantics. Semanticists explore how words and phrases gain meaning, how meanings change over time, and the relationships between words and concepts.

    The name “Brandt” has a fascinating history, originating as a Germanic occupational surname. Its roots lie in the Middle Ages when society was heavily structured around trades and crafts.

    In Old German, “Brande” referred to a brand or burning mark, often used on livestock for identification. Individuals who worked with fire or metalwork, such as blacksmiths or armorers, likely acquired this surname, indicating their profession.

    Over time, the surname evolved into its modern form, “Brandt,” reflecting linguistic shifts within Germanic languages.

    The name’s popularity spread beyond Germany, finding its way to Scandinavia and eventually reaching England through migration and trade networks.

    Today, “Brandt” exists as both a surname and a given name, often found in countries with strong Germanic cultural influences.

    Variations and Nicknames:

    • Brand: A shortened form of Brandt, prevalent in Scandinavian regions.
    • Brant: Another common variation, particularly in English-speaking areas.
    • Brande: This form retains a closer resemblance to the original Old German root and is found in parts of Germany and Europe.
    • Branden: A slightly altered version, more prevalent as a given name.
    • Brantley: An anglicized variant with added geographical connotations, possibly originating from an area associated with the “Brande” surname.

    These variations illustrate how language evolves and adapts, preserving elements of the original meaning while reflecting regional influences and personal preferences.

    The name “Brandt” has a fascinating history rooted in Germanic languages and signifies more than just a given name. It traces its origins back to Old High German where it evolved from the word “brand,” meaning “sword” or “fire.” This dual symbolism speaks volumes about the potential connotations associated with the name.

    In early medieval Europe, the association of “Brandt” with “sword” likely linked individuals bearing the name to concepts of bravery, strength, and perhaps even a warrior spirit. Conversely, the connection to “fire” could suggest qualities like passion, energy, and even a touch of danger.

    Over time, “Brandt” spread across Germanic-speaking regions, evolving into various forms in different languages. In Germany, it became common as both a given name and a surname, while in Scandinavian countries, it appeared as “Brand” or similar variations.
